WHEN GOD PUTS ON THE BRAKES

While gray daylight spread over the valley
Three unbroken colts jumped and whinnied, maniacally
Enraged by the giant clouds
Which spat thunderbolts down upon them

Behind them an army of wailing wolves
Shot fear darts through their minds
Creating a fantastical frenzy
When my son Griffin, came down, from the sky

"You shall not pass this way again my friends,
Perhaps you should stay here for a while,
I'm expecting what might have been."
Then BANG, the lightning had left them for dead.........

Tony Taylor (Chicago)
